Sesame Focaccia
There’s nothing quite like homemade focaccia fresh out of the oven—light, airy, and crisp around the edges with that signature chewy bounce. I love topping it with a generous layer of sesame seeds for extra nuttiness and crunch, but this is where you can get creative. Go wild with whatever toppings you’re craving—za’atar, sliced shallots, tomatoes, olives, or even a swipe of chili crisp right before baking. This dough uses a high hydration and a long fermentation for incredible flavor and structure. Yes, the waiting is worth it. It’s what gives you those deep bubbles and that golden, delicate crust. If you don’t have a stand mixer, I highly recommend looking up a video on how to properly knead high hydration dough by hand—it’s a different technique but totally doable. *Best Practices* *1. Let the dough ferment fully in the fridge* This gives the focaccia better flavor and texture. Don’t rush this step. *2. Use a metal baking pan* It conducts heat better, giving you that crispy bottom and golden edges. *3. Generously oil the pan and the dough* This helps prevent sticking and encourages that signature crust. *4. Wet your hands when working with the dough* It’s sticky—water is your best tool here. *5. Dimple the dough right before baking* Use your fingers to press deep into the dough, creating those signature focaccia pockets for oil and flavor to pool in. *6. Bake until deeply golden* Don’t pull it early. That extra color adds tons of flavor and texture. *7. Let it cool slightly before slicing* The steam will redistribute and keep the crumb light and fluffy.
